A Mount Vernon man was arrested early Sunday morning after he allegedly choked his girlfriend following a domestic dispute, police said.

David D. Henry, 30, twice tried to choke his 34-year-old live-in girlfriend and was repulsed when she struck him with an iron and stabbed him with a knife, according to a Mount Vernon city news release.
